The mixed fajitas are 24.99 but they don't tell you up front that this is just for the chicken fajitas. If you want to add a protein, its 2.00 for carne asada or 2.00 for vaca frita. Shrimp is an option but it is not listed on the menu. You can ask for it but the server wont tell you its an additional 7.50 up charge. Simply put, if you don't ask about pricing, you will pay 34.49 for a fajita trio of chicken, carne asada, and shrimp. Our server was also not attentive the second time around. El área de Kendall debe su nombre a Henry John Bion Kendall, un director de la Florida Land and Mortgage Company a finales del siglo XIX. Originalmente, esta región era predominantemente agrícola, con vastas extensiones de tierras dedicadas al cultivo de aguacates, mangos y otras frutas tropicales. La proximidad a los Everglades influenció la geografía y el desarrollo inicial de la zona.
A medida que Miami experimentaba un crecimiento explosivo en el siglo XX, Kendall comenzó su transformación de un paisaje rural a un suburbio residencial. Después de la Segunda Guerra Mundial, la expansión de la infraestructura y la afluencia de nuevas poblaciones, especialmente de inmigrantes latinoamericanos, impulsaron un desarrollo significativo. La construcción de autopistas como la Florida's Turnpike y el Don Shula Expressway (SR 874) facilitó el acceso y convirtió a Kendall en un destino atractivo para familias que buscaban viviendas más espaciosas y asequibles que en el centro de Miami.
West Kendall, donde se ubica Latin House Grill, es hoy un testimonio vivo de la diversidad cultural de Miami. Es un área predominantemente residencial, caracterizada por comunidades planificadas, centros comerciales y una abundancia de parques y espacios verdes. La demografía es rica y variada, con una fuerte presencia de comunidades cubana, venezolana, colombiana, nicaragüense y de otras naciones latinoamericanas. Esta mezcla cultural se refleja en todos los aspectos de la vida en West Kendall, desde las escuelas hasta los supermercados y, por supuesto, la oferta gastronómica.
La influencia latina es palpable en cada esquina. Los supermercados ofrecen productos importados de América Latina, las panaderías preparan dulces tradicionales y los pequeños negocios reflejan el espíritu emprendedor de la comunidad. Es un lugar donde el español se escucha con tanta frecuencia como el inglés, y donde las tradiciones y festividades de diversos países se celebran con entusiasmo.

La parrilla es una forma de arte en América Latina. No es solo cocinar con fuego, sino una técnica que requiere paciencia, habilidad y un profundo conocimiento de los cortes de carne y sus tiempos de cocción. Desde el asado argentino hasta la carne asada colombiana o venezolana, la parrilla es un ritual social que celebra la reunión y la buena comida.
En Latin House Grill, se puede esperar que esta tradición sea honrada. Esto significa carnes marinadas con especias auténticas, cocinadas lentamente sobre brasas para lograr una corteza caramelizada y un interior jugoso y tierno. Los cortes pueden variar desde el churrasco y la picaña hasta el vacío y la entraña, cada uno con su textura y sabor distintivos. La clave es la simplicidad y la calidad del producto, realzadas por el fuego y las manos expertas del parrillero.
